Rocket Adventure

Rocket Adventure

Build an exciting space game where players pilot a rocket through outer space, avoid dangerous asteroids, collect points, and reach the finish line safely while learning game development in Scratch.

Students create a complete scrolling space adventure game from scratch by programming rocket movement, asteroid obstacles, collision detection, scoring, sound effects, and winning conditions. Along the way, they strengthen their understanding of variables, broadcasts, conditionals, loops, coordinates, and problem-solving while designing their own interactive game experience.

Spiral Drawing Generator

Spiral Drawing Generator

Kaja Kengatharan

Create a fun Spiral Drawing Generator in Snap! where pressing different number keys draws unique colourful spiral patterns using loops, pen commands, and rotation angles.

Kaja built an interactive drawing program in Snap! that generates a variety of geometric spiral designs based on keyboard input. He learned how to use loops, variables, pen blocks, angles, events, and coordinate positioning while exploring how changing rotation values creates different mathematical patterns and artistic designs.

Frequently Asked Questions

Find answers to common questions about classes, courses, schedules, and getting started.

Does my child need any previous coding experience?

No. Many students join with no prior coding experience. Our Level 1 courses introduce the basics step by step, while higher-level courses are available for students who want to continue building their skills.

How do I know which level is right for my child?

Each program is divided into levels based on difficulty and experience. Beginners should start with Level 1, while students with previous experience may be able to begin at a higher level. If you are unsure, our team can help recommend the best starting point.

How long are the classes?

Classes are typically 1.5 hours per session. Each session includes instruction, guided practice, and time for students to work on their own projects with support from their instructor.

What will my child create during the course?

Students learn by building real projects. Depending on the program, they may create games, animations, apps, websites, Python programs, Roblox experiences, and other digital creations that they can share with their family.

What does my child need to join the classes?

Students need a computer or laptop with internet access. Any additional requirements for specific courses will be shared before the class begins.

Who teaches the classes?

Our instructors have backgrounds in technology, coding, and education. They focus on making lessons engaging, practical, and easy for students to understand.

What happens after I register?

After registration, you will receive the class schedule and information needed to get started. Your child can then join their live sessions and begin learning through hands-on projects.

Are the courses only for students interested in becoming programmers?

No. Coding helps students develop creativity, problem-solving, and logical thinking skills that are useful in many areas. Our courses are designed for students who want to explore technology, create projects, and build confidence with digital tools.
